A Novel Complex Networks Clustering Algorithm Based on the Core Influence of Nodes
In complex networks, cluster structure, identified by the heterogeneity of nodes, has become a common and important topological property. Network clustering methods are thus significant for the study of complex networks. Currently, many typical clustering algorithms have some weakness like inaccurac...
